Mahraganat dancing is The key reason why it really is publicized just as much as it has. The dancing for Mahraganat is incredibly expressive and distinctive to this music model. Typically, younger Egyptian Guys dance to this by transferring their arms in all sorts of motions, bending down, and leaping up into the beat from the music. Dancers just go their hands and bodies in almost any method to match the track’s rhythm, typically at an exceptionally fast pace.

Weddings in Cairo’s popular quarters are segregated. Guys and ladies can chat, but they have got separate seating—and dancing—arrangements, Males inside the front of your phase and girls tucked again at the rear of or beside it. Ahmed Suessi, a twenty-calendar year-aged mahragan singer, appeared stunned After i instructed him that twenty years in the past persons mingled freely at weddings.

The music is Uncooked artificial beat embroidered with syncopated tabla (Egyptian drum) samples and queasy Digital loops. The voices with the young Males in pores and skin-restricted denims stalking onstage across the mixing board are auto-tuned to a pointy metallic edge. Inside of hours of a major marriage, cellphone-recorded clips will circulate over the internet; fame, for A few of these singers, might be simply a YouTube upload absent.
